How long does flat roof replacement last in Bothell?
EPDM and TPO last ~20–25 years; PVC up to 30. Standing water shortens any flat-roof membrane.
Twice-yearly inspections to clear drains, reseal seams, and catch ponding before it causes leaks.
Signs you need flat roof replacement in Bothell
- Standing water (ponding) that lingers more than 48 hours after rain
- Blisters, bubbles, or splits in the membrane
- Seams or flashing lifting, cracking, or pulling apart
- Interior water stains, drips, or a sagging deck
- The membrane is brittle, cracked, or shrinking with age
- Repeated patch repairs that no longer hold
Repair or replace in Bothell?
Repair if…
- Leaks trace to isolated seams, flashing, or a single puncture
- The membrane is under ~15 years old and otherwise sound
- A reflective recoat can extend the existing membrane's life
Replace if…
- The membrane is brittle, blistered, or splitting across the roof
- Chronic ponding has saturated the insulation or decking
- The roof is past 20 years and leaking in multiple spots

Why flat roof replacement quotes vary — and how to compare them fairly
Two bids for the “same” job can differ by thousands. Usually it's scope, not greed — here's what moves the number and how to get an apples-to-apples comparison.
Why a quote looks high (or low)
- One bid is a full tear-off; another lays new shingles over the old roof — cheaper now, costlier later.
- Deck repair, underlayment grade and ventilation may or may not be in the price.
- A storm-chaser's lowball often skips flashing, ice-and-water shield or a real warranty.
Get an apples-to-apples bid
- Confirm underlayment, ice-and-water shield, flashing and ventilation are included.
- Verify the contractor is licensed, insured and local, with recent references.
- Specify tear-off vs. overlay so all bids match.
- Ask how deck/sheathing repairs are priced if rot is found.
Questions to ask Bothell Roofing pros
Comparing quotes is only fair when they cover the same scope. Ask every bidder these before you sign.
- 1Is a full tear-off included, or are you laying over the existing roof?
- 2How will you handle deck repairs or rotten sheathing found after tear-off, and at what rate?
- 3What underlayment, ice-and-water shield, and ventilation are included?
- 4Are you licensed and insured here, and can you share recent local references?
- 5What's the workmanship warranty, and how does it interact with the material warranty?
